ABOUT
THE DOCTOR
Upon graduating from Palmer College of Chiropractic
in 1987, Dr. Fuller did a one year externship in Delphi, Indiana
with Dr. Thomas Brodar. In 1988, Dr. Fuller set up his private
practice in Brownsburg and has been treating families ever since.
He has been married to his wife, Dawn, since 1996 and they have
3 boys. Dr. Fuller has had extensive post graduate education including
a certification in Spinal Trauma.
